DAN“s
Automated External
Defibrillators (AEDs) for Aquatic Emergencies Course,
represents entry-level training designed to educate the general public
to better recognize the warning signs of Sudden Cardiac Arrest and
administer first aid using Basic Life Support techniques and Automated
External Defibrillators while activating the local emergency medical
services (EMS) and / or arranging for evacuation to the nearest
appropriate medical facility.

DAN
Instructors are scuba diving educators who want to offer dive safety
programs to their students. Once you have taken the
DAN Instructor
Qualification Course,
and met the other prerequisites below, you can teach The AED Module.
Prerequisites for taking the DAN Automated External Defibrillator
Instructor Course:
Successfully complete the
DAN Instructor Qualification Course
DAN Member
Active
scuba diving educator*
Current
CPR Instructor
Documentation of First Aid training
